auto parking systems, also known as automated valet parking systems, are designed to make parking painless and efficient for drivers. These systems typically utilize sensors, such as ultrasonic or cameras, to detect available parking spaces. Once a spot is identified, the system takes control of the vehicle and guides it into the parking space with little to no input from the driver. This not only eliminates the stress and frustration of maneuvering into tight spaces but also reduces the risk of accidents and scratches that can occur during manual parking.

One of the key advantages of auto parking systems is their ability to maximize the use of limited parking space. By employing advanced algorithms and precise sensors, these systems can park vehicles closer together than would be possible with manual parking. This means that more cars can fit into a given area, increasing the overall efficiency of parking lots and garages. For urban areas where parking space is at a premium, auto parking systems offer a solution to the perennial problem of finding a spot.

Despite their numerous benefits, auto parking systems are not without their drawbacks. One of the primary concerns is the potential for system failure or malfunction. Like any technology, auto parking systems are not infallible and may encounter issues such as sensor malfunctions or software glitches. This can result in delays and frustration for drivers who are unable to park or retrieve their vehicles in a timely manner. Additionally, there is a perception among some drivers that auto parking systems are less safe than manual parking, as they require a certain level of trust in the technology to navigate tight spaces and obstacles.

Another concern with auto parking systems is the cost associated with implementing and maintaining the technology. While the initial investment in auto parking systems can be significant, the long-term benefits in terms of efficiency and space utilization may justify the expense for parking lot operators and developers. However, the cost of maintenance and repairs can add up over time, particularly if the systems are not properly maintained or upgraded. This can be a deterrent for smaller parking facilities or businesses that may not have the resources to invest in cutting-edge technology.
